## **Objectives of the PTFA** 

This Parent Teacher and Friends Association (PTFA) was first set up in January 2018 by the principal of the school. The PTFA’s main purpose is fundraising, to which money goes towards items or activities outside of the school budget. While fundraising is our main objective, we would like to think the PTFA also gives the opportunity for parents/caregivers, staff and children a chance to interact on a social level while working towards a common goal. 

## **Registered Charity & Constitution** 

Cliftonville Integrated Primary School PTFA is an official registered Charity with the Northern Ireland Chairty Commission. **Charity Number:108590** , we gained Charity status in November 2022. Along with being a registered charity we also follow the Parent Kind Model Constitution which outlines how we run our organisation, hold meetings and conduct ourselves.

## **Fundraising Events held from January 2023 - December 2023** 

**Tuck Shop at Sports Day (23[rd] May 2023)** – It was wonderful to be back out and engaging with the school community by supporting our school’s sports day with tea, coffee and snacks. There were costs incurred to purchase stock (which profit was made from subsequent tuck shops), water heater and banner at £551.49 and these are outlined further in the report in the statement of accounts. We raised £362.57 on the day but made a loss of £23.79. 

**Tuck Shop at P7 Play (8[th] June 2023)** – We really enjoyed camping outside with drinks & snacks for those parents going in to see the play and raised the sum of £143. 

**Shorts & Shades Day (16[th] June 2023)** – The children looked amazing and very cool on our shorts & shades day, we got some lovely photos sent to us on Facebook to put on our page and we really appreciated the support from parents/caregivers in donating £1 on the day. Total raised was £381 

**Tuck Shop for children in school (28[th] June 2023)** – We ran this tuck shop throughout the day while we were in the assembly hall for our uniform swap shop. It was wonderful to see so many smiling and excited children. I was very impressed with the manners of our children attending Cliftonville, so very polite and patient in lining up to buy their treats. 

**Halloween Disco (26[th] October 2023)** – It was an absolute treat to be back in the school and holding a disco for the children. All the children looked amazing and had a blast dancing away and munching on some goodies from the tuck shop. We really appreciated parental donation of £2 per child for the disco and sending in funds for the children to purchase from the tuck shop. We had a cost of DJ and stock to purchase for this event but a profit of £620.08 was made. 

**Class Fundraising Christmas Project (Oct – Nov 2023)** – This was our first time trying out this type of project, the children got sent home a template to create a Christmas/winter picture. **Tuck Shop at Christmas Disco (21[st] December 2023)** – While we did not organise the Christmas disco, we did provide a tuck shop on the day. The children had a wonderful time and enjoyed their treats from the tuck shop, we were sold out well before the disco had finished. A few more additional items were purchased at a cost of £105.73 and the rest of the stock we had from Halloween. A profit of £345.55 was made. 

## **Funds Provided by PTFA to the school** 

P7 Leavers Event in June 2023 (Hire of inflatables) - £210 

Gardening club in September 2023 - £500 

Accelerated Reading Prizes (AR) in September 2023 - £250
